    Marseille-based container line CMA CGM will apply new Freight All Kinds (FAK) rates from all Asian main ports to all Mediterranean base ports and North Africa.

    The following rates will apply to dry, out of gauge (OOG), paying empties, and reefer cargo beginning 1 November 2023:

    Destinations 20′ 40’/40’HC/40’REEFER
    West Med US$1,400 US$2,000
    Adriatic US$1,550 US$2,100
    East Med US$1,600 US$2,100
    Black Sea US$1,750 US$2,200
    Syria EUR 2,600 EUR 4,700
    Algeria US$2,550 US$4,100
    Tunisia US$2,850 US$4,200
    Libya US$2,450 US$3,600
    Morocco US$1,750 US$2,700

    Additionally, the French box carrier has announced updated FAK rates from all Asian ports (including Japan, South East Asia, and Bangladesh) to all North European ports (including the United Kingdom and the entire range from Portugal to Finland/Estonia).

    From 1 November (the day of loading at the origin ports) until further notice, the new FAK rates will be as follows for dry, OOG, paying empties and reefer cargo.

    20’GP 40’GP/40’HC/40’REEFER
    Asia to North Europe US$1,000 US$1,800
